Nháy theo nhạc sử dụng STM8S hiển thị VFD - Audio spectrum analyzer
Chào các bạn, code được viết trên vi điều khiển STM8S003F3 không sử dụng thuật toán FFT, mà sử dụng lấy mẫu ADC rồi sau đó đưa qua các thuật toán làm mượt dữ liệu tạo các cột nháy đẹp mắt theo tín hiệu âm thanh đưa vào.
Nguyên lý điều khiển màn hình VFD:
- Điện áp hai đầu sợi dây nung 4-5V (AC or DC) ở đây dùng DC (có nhược điểm là màn hình sẽ bị mờ dần về phía cựa dương do hiện tượng phát xạ electron), dòng tiêu thụ 200-250mA
- Điện áp chân quét Grid: +15V (Điện áp càng cao thì càng sáng, cao quá sẽ cháy @@)
- Điện áp chân dữ liệu điểm sáng cực Anot: +15V (Tương tự lưới Grid)
Như vậy với điện áp trên thì chúng ta sẽ sử dụng IC ghi dịch CD4094 có điện áp hoạt động trong khoảng 15V làm ic driver cho lưới grid và cực anot. Để giao tiếp được với ic ghi dịch chuẩn điện áp 15V, các bạn phải đệm logic các chân dữ liệu nối tiếp từ vi điều khiển ra (do MCU chạy điện áp 3.3-5V) các bạn sử dụng mạch đảo logic dùng transistor C1815 và trở kéo 10K từ cực C lên 15V, cực B nối trở 1K về MCU, cực E nối GND. Trong chương trình các bạn phải đổi mức logic cấp ra port vi điều khiển để ic ghi dịch hoạt động đúng do ta sử dụng cổng NOT.
Nguyên lý quét màn hình VFD tương tự như quét led 7 thanh và led matrix, ta sẽ cấp nguồn cho dây nung để màn hình hoạt động, sau đó cấp lần lượt điện áp vào chân quét lưới đồng thời xuất dữ liệu điểm ảnh ra chân anot của màn hình tất cả ở logic cao 15V màn hình sẽ phát sáng theo vị trí của lưới và cực anot được cấp nguồn. Theo nguyên lý phát xạ electron, các phân tử trên dây nung (cực phát xạ catot) khi bị nung nóng, các elec bị kích thích bắn ra ngoài trong môi trường chân không, các elec này sẽ bị các cực anot (cực dương) hút về phía mình, các elec sẽ bị lưới grid giữ lại nếu lưới đang ở mức 0 và tăng tốc xuyên qua lưới khi grid ở mức cao khoảng 15V, khi elec bay tới và đập vào cực anot được phủ một lớp photpho sẽ làm các phân tử photpho bị kích thích và phát ra photon ánh sáng làm điểm ảnh phát sáng, màu sắc của điểm ảnh do hàm lượng tạp chất được pha trong photpho.
Tải về đính kèm: